分类: 电脑网络

关注IT行业、互联网信息。包括计算机硬件、软件、网站开发、平面设计、网络杂谈等.

  • 帝国CMS灵动标签调用专题栏目导航

    [e:loop={‘select ztid,ztname,ztpath from [!db.pre!]enewszt where showzt=0 order by ztid limit 10’,10,24,0}]

    <li><a href=”<?=$public_r[newsurl]?><?=$bqr[ztpath]?>” title=”<?=$bqr[ztname]?>”><?=$bqr[ztname]?></a></li>

    [/e:loop]

  • dedecms子目录转移到根目录替换图片路径

    修改内容图片和缩略图链接

    内容页图片路径用后台的“数据库内容替换”功能即可,进入后台“数据库内容替换”,找到数据表“dede_addonarticle”,选择字段“body”,然后替换成自己想要的路径就可以了。(将uploads批量修改替换成/news/uploads)

    缩略图替换原理一样,进入后台“数据库内容替换”,找到数据表“dede_archives”,选择字段“litpic”,然后替换成自己的路径就可以了。

  • 帝国如何用灵动标签调用会员列表?

    [e:loop={“select u.username,u.userid,ui.company from phome_enewsmember u LEFT JOIN phome_enewsmemberadd ui ON u.userid=ui.userid where u.groupid=2 limit 10″,10,24,0}]

    <li>·<a href=”/e/space/?userid=<?=$bqr[userid]?>” title='<?=$bqr[company]?>’ /><?=sub($bqr[company],0,18,false)?></a><br />

    [/e:loop]

  • 帝国CMS灵动标签按SQL查询

    帝国CMS灵动标签按SQL查询实例:

    例一:

    [e:loop={“select * from [!db.pre!]ecms_article order by rand() desc limit 8″,8,24,0}]

    <li><a class=”green” href=”<?=$bqsr[classurl]?>” target=”_blank”>[<?=$bqsr[classname]?>]</a><a href=”<?=$bqsr[titleurl]?>” target=”_blank” title=”<?=esub($bqr[oldtitle],40)?>”><?=esub($bqr[title],38)?></a></li>

    [/e:loop]

    这个例子主要是用帝国CMS系统调用某个数据表([!db.pre!]ecms_article)下的随机文章,我在这里主调用的文章数据表,[!db.pre!]指的数据表前缀。里面的数字8指的是8条信息,24是按SQL数据查询。

    例二:

    [e:loop={“select * from [!db.pre!]ecms_article where classid in(4) order by rand() desc limit 10″,10,24,0}]

    <li class=”no<?=$bqno+20?>”><span>[<a class=”green” title=”纯文字”>文</a>]</span><a href=”<?=$bqsr[titleurl]?>” target=”_blank” title=”<?=esub($bqr[oldtitle],40)?>”><?=esub($bqr[title],28)?></a></li>

    [/e:loop]

    这个实例也是我们比较常用的。与例一有一点点不同,where classid in(4) 这里指的是栏目ID,调用指点的栏目。no<?=$bqno+20?>还有这个,指定一个CLASS,这样用样式可以表达出不同的效果,$bqno是从1开始的,后面加20后,class=no21

  • 帝国CMS灵动标签调用栏目+标题+摘要+缩略图

    [e:loop={栏目ID/专题ID,显示条数,操作类型,只显示有标题图片}]

    栏目名称:<?=$bqsr[classname]?>

    栏目链接:<?=$bqsr[classurl]?>

    标题:<?=$bqr[title]?>

    标题链接:<?=$bqsr[titleurl]?>

    摘要:<?=$bqr[smalltext]?>

    缩略图:<img src=”<?=$bqr[titlepic]?>”>

    [/e:loop]

  • google技巧大全收集

    1、definition:到GOOGLE搜索框输入一个英文单词,然后空格加definition可以得到此英文单词的音标及真人发音。如dog definition ,有兴趣大家可以试试,对学习英文很有帮忙。

    (未完待续……)

  • 帝国CMS100%简单实现导航高亮效果(方法二)

    <body XXXXXXXXX>改为
    <body id=”channle<?=user_GetTopBclassid($GLOBALS[navclassid])?>”>

    然后把
    //取得顶级栏目ID函数
    function user_GetTopBclassid($classid){
    global $class_r;
    $fr=explode(‘|’,$class_r[$classid][featherclass]);
    $topbclassid=$fr[1]?$fr[1]:$classid;//取得第一级栏目id
    return $topbclassid;
    }

    加入到  e/class/userfun.php   中就可以了

    =======注:这种方法动态页面都不能获取ID==========

  • 帝国CMS100%简单实现导航高亮效果(方法一)

    curr:为高亮样式

    [e:loop={“select classid,classname,classpath from [!db.pre!]enewsclass where bclassid=0 order by myorder,classid asc”,0,24,0}]
    <?
    $class=””;
    if($GLOBALS[navclassid]==$bqr[classid])
    $class=”curr”;
    {
    ?>
    <li><a  href=”<?=$public_r[newsurl]?><?=$bqr[classpath]?>” target=”_self”><?=$bqr[classname]?></a></li>
    <?php
    }
    ?>
    [/e:loop]

  • 在本地计算机上配置java、jsp运行环境

    很多java初学者,对于java环境配置以及jsp运行环境配置,可能不太了解,那么今天为了巩固大家的知识,我就再一次为大家写一篇很简单的教程,希望对大家有用!


    1、准备阶段
    首先我们必须要准备以下两款软件
    1)JDK(可以到java官方网站下载,目前sun公司已经被Oracle收购了,大家可以到Oracle网站上去下载最新版的JDK),下载地址是http://www.oracle.com/technetwork/java/javase/downloads/index.html
    2)tomcat(可以到apache官方网站上下载最新版tomcat),下载地址http://tomcat.apache.org/
    2、搭建java环境
    首先我们将JDK安装完成后,需要对系统变量进行修改
    1)XP系统中,右击“我的电脑”–“属性”–“高级”–“环境变量”,如果是win7系统,那么就是右击“计算机”–“属性”–“高级系统设置”。新建一个变量名为java_home,其变量值为JDK所在的路径,如图
    然后再打开原有的系统变量Path,在Path中添加JDK文件目录下的bin目录我的路径为C:\Program Files\Java\jdk1.6.0_24\bin,如图
    然后再建立一个classpath变量名,将JDK目录下的lib目录中的tools.jar以及dt.jar的路径写入其中,不过这里我们要是有java_home变量,那么我们就将其写为.;%JAVA_HOME%\lib\tools.jar;%JAVA_HOME%\lib\dt.jar;(注意,最前面有一个点号哦)如图
    完成后,直接点击确定即可,这样就设置好了java运行环境了,如果想要测试下是否已经成功了,那么我们可以打开命令提示符,或者“运行”–“CMD”,在命令提示符中输入java或者是javac,如果看到如下图所示,则表示环境搭建成功,如果不成功,请检查JDK路径是否正确!

    3、搭建jsp运行环境

    这里我们需要使用到tomcat软件,JDK安装配置完成后,我们才可以安装tomcat,安装完成tomcat后就不需要对环境变量进行设置了,jsp运行环境也就搭建成功了,然后可以在浏览器访问http://localhost:8080看看能否访问到tomcat服务器的主页,你可以将自己编写的html文档或者jsp文档放到tomcat目录下的webapps下自己新建的文件夹(比如我新建一个叫做test的文件夹),然后通过http://localhost:8080/test/test.jsp即可访问相应的页面!

     

    总体来说搭建java环境和jsp环境是很简单的,并不复杂。不过在服务器的应用中,可能就会复杂一些,比如使用tomcat建立虚拟主机等等就需要你懂得tomcat中某些文件的修改及配置了!

  • IE(IE6/IE7/IE8)支持HTML5标签

    让IE(ie6/ie7/ie8)支持HTML5元素,我们需要在HTML头部添加以下JavaScript,这是一个简单的document.createElement声明,利用条件注释针对IE来调用这个js文件。Opera,FireFox等其他非IE浏览器就会忽视这段代码,也不会存在http请求。

    方式一:引用google的html5.js文件,代码内容可以自己下载下来看。

    <!–[if lt IE9]>

    <script src=”http://html5shiv.googlecode.com/svn/trunk/html5.js”></script>

    <![endif]–>

    将以上代码放到head标签区间

    方式二:自己coding JS搞定。

    <script>

    (function() {

    if (!

    /*@cc_on!@*/

    0) return;

    var e = “abbr, article, aside, audio, canvas, datalist, details, dialog, eventsource, figure, footer, header, hgroup, mark, menu, meter, nav, output, progress, section, time, video”.split(‘, ‘);

    var i= e.length;

    while (i–){

    document.createElement(e[i])

    }

    })()

    </script>

    不管你用上面哪中方式,请记得在CSS中进行如下定义,目的是让这些标签成为块状元素,just like div。

    /*html5*/

    article,aside,dialog,footer,header,section,footer,nav,figure,menu{display:block}